Driving the Haoying, I found setting up dashboard options 1 and 2 quite straightforward. After starting the engine, there are usually control buttons on the right side of the steering wheel. I gently press them with my index finger, scrolling left and right to find the 'Personalized Settings' or similar menu. Selecting 'Setting 1' might adjust the display mode, such as switching to an eco-mode that reminds you of fuel consumption; 'Setting 2' could be for custom content, like adding trip mileage or average speed. Remember to stop or slow down when operating these settings, as distraction can easily lead to accidents. I make it a habit to confirm my settings before each drive, as it enhances driving comfort—for example, setting 2 to display navigation assistance during long trips reduces the hassle of checking my phone. Don’t be afraid to make mistakes; these functions are designed for safety, and you’ll get the hang of it after a few tries.

What Causes the Brake Caliper to Make Abnormal Noises on Rough Roads?

Abnormal noises from the brake caliper on rough roads indicate a malfunction. More information on abnormal noises from vehicles on rough roads is as follows: 1. Chassis noises due to loose bolts: These noises are easily understood—when components that should be firmly fastened become loose, they naturally rattle and produce noise. 2. Noises from the exhaust pipe: Loose screws on the heat shield near the exhaust pipe, loose or leaking connections at various joints of the exhaust pipe, and rust or damage to the exhaust pipe can all cause abnormal noises. 3. Issues with the braking system: Worn brake pads, uneven wear between the brake disc and brake pads, among other reasons, can lead to abnormal braking noises. Brake pad issues are one of the main causes of abnormal noises, as brake pads wear out and are consumable parts that require regular replacement. Brake pads should be considered for replacement when their thickness wears down to less than 3mm, with 2mm being the absolute limit for replacement. Generally, front brake pads have a service life of around 50,000 kilometers, while rear brake discs and pads last about 120,000 kilometers. Additionally, if the brake pads are of poor quality (too hard), they can also produce abnormal noises. Besides brake pads and discs, malfunctions in the brake caliper, master cylinder, or other components can also generate abnormal noises.

What documents should a 4S dealership provide when purchasing a new car?

When picking up a new car, the 4S dealership should provide the following documents: car keys (usually two sets); vehicle certification; motor vehicle VAT invoice; three-guarantee vehicle certificate; vehicle maintenance manual; simplified vehicle user manual, and other related documents. The maintenance manual and three-guarantee service card are essential. The maintenance manual serves as a guide for vehicle upkeep, while the three-guarantee service card is a warranty commitment covering repairs, replacements, and refunds during the warranty period. Important Notes: When picking up the car, carefully inspect the exterior and engine. Also, check the undercarriage by lifting the vehicle; examine windows, including the window regulators, switches, and critical components like the air conditioning. Verify engine oil levels, automatic transmission fluid levels, tire conditions, and cross-check vehicle and engine numbers (for new cars) to ensure no prior repairs. Ensure all included accessories are present, such as the warning triangle, jack, spare tire, and other tools. Essential documents the 4S dealership must provide: Vehicle Certification: The vehicle certification is a crucial document required for registration. Without it, the car cannot be registered. Some 4S dealerships may delay providing this document, which can affect registration. Always request it promptly. Purchase Invoice: After payment, the 4S dealership will issue a purchase invoice. This invoice is necessary for registration and future resale. Carefully verify all details on the invoice, such as the amount, ID number, and VIN, as manual entries may contain errors. Vehicle Conformity Certificate: This certificate contains detailed vehicle information. Verify all details upon receipt. Maintenance and Warranty Manuals: The three-guarantee manual, maintenance manual, and user manual are indispensable. The maintenance manual provides solutions for common issues, while the three-guarantee manual is used for major quality issues involving refunds or replacements. The maintenance manual also includes a free first-service voucher, which is required for complimentary initial maintenance. Vehicle Registration Certificate: Commonly known as the "Big Green Book," this certificate serves as the car's "household register." It is essential for transferring ownership or registration. Note that for financed vehicles, this certificate is usually held by the bank until the loan is fully repaid. For financed vehicles, additional documents include the original insurance policy, insurance invoice, compulsory traffic insurance invoice, vehicle tax invoice, purchase tax invoice, tax payment certificate, and compulsory insurance label.

Why are parallel imported cars not popular?

Parallel imported cars are not popular because they lack manufacturer authorization. Here is an introduction to parallel imported cars: 1. Concept: The full name is parallel trade imported cars, referred to as parallel trade cars, meaning cars that are purchased by traders from overseas markets and sold in the Chinese market without brand manufacturer authorization. 2. Advantages: Model and delivery time advantages. Sometimes, after new cars are launched overseas, they may not be available in China due to some automakers' strategic plans or domestic certification issues. However, parallel imported cars have natural advantages in this regard.

What do the D, S, and M gears in a car mean?

Car D, S, and M gears refer to: 1. D gear: (Drive: driving) is the forward gear, the driving gear. Before shifting into this gear, you must first step on the brake, because most vehicles will move even if you don't step on the accelerator when in this gear. However, most cars nowadays cannot shift into D gear without stepping on the brake. When using this gear, the vehicle will automatically shift up or down according to driving conditions. 2. S gear: (Sport: sports) is the sports gear. As the name suggests, it is the sports mode. Not all automatic transmission vehicles have this gear. It improves the vehicle's acceleration by increasing throttle sensitivity, engine speed, and extending shift time, but fuel consumption will also increase at this time. It is generally used for overtaking, because sometimes overtaking at high speed with D gear can be difficult, while S gear is specifically designed for overtaking. 3. M gear: Manual mode. Generally, vehicles with a manual-automatic transmission have this gear, and there are "+" and "-" symbols next to it, meaning that manual shifting is possible. However, if the engine speed does not meet the requirements of the driving computer, the gear cannot be shifted up, and when the speed is too low, the driving computer will automatically shift down.

What is the function of the rubber plugs on car side skirts?

Rubber plugs prevent leaks and also serve an isolating function, preventing connection with the external atmosphere. Here is additional information: 1. Leak prevention and isolation: They provide a sealing effect, protecting against wind, dust, and water. Without them, metal would contact metal when closing doors, which over time could cause door deformation gaps, increase noise, and affect air conditioning efficiency. They can be used with paper gaskets or directly applied to various shell contact surfaces as rubber pads, or utilize their own adhesiveness to attach plastic films. 2. Precautions: It is recommended not to remove the buffer rubber plugs to prevent door deformation. This is directly related to the safety of the vehicle occupants.
